Subject: Concentration Risk — Quick Flag

Team,

Heads up: Marlowe Freight now accounts for nearly forty percent of Quillstone's revenue. If their renewal slips, Q2 gets bumpy. Each department head, please sketch exposure on your side by Friday — pipeline, staffing, commitments. Our mitigation thinking so far is captured in the note below.

internal memo for kawip-hadug: Headcount on the Wenwyn team goes from 7 to 140 by the end of January. Gross margin on Wenwyn came in at 20 percent against a plan of 15 percent.

Quarterly Planning Note — Divestiture of the Coastal Tooling Unit

For the finance team: the sale of the Coastal Tooling unit to Pellmark Industries remains on track for close in Q3. Please finalize the carve-out balance sheet, reconcile intercompany positions, and prepare the working-capital adjustment schedule by month-end. Audit support requests should be prioritized. For planning purposes, note the following sensitive item:

internal memo for hawef-kahif: The finance team signed off on a budget of $25.9 million for Project Sorox. The renewal with Pelokek Logistics closes at $51.7 million a year, 52 percent below the last contract.

**Vendor note: Inkmill markdown pipeline**

Rendering for Parchway docs is outsourced to Inkmill under an annual contract, renewing each March. They handle sanitization and PDF export; we own the upload queue. SLA: 4-hour response on rendering failures. Escalate only after two failed retries. Their support desk is reachable at the address below.

billing contact of hahaf-baguf = zorael.tammir.jorius@sivrelhq.internal

Visitor policy addendum: the roof-terrace door at Stennamore House continues to jam in cold weather, so night staff must never allow visitors onto the terrace unescorted. Check the latch fully engages after every use, and record each opening in the night log. Should the door seize with someone outside, release it using the override code below.

door code, yagap-bahof: bdg-O-05

Matchcore GC-pause dashboard is blank because the metrics scraper's credentials expired Tuesday. Support: pause alerts are NOT firing until this is fixed — check latency manually. Rotation via Vaultspin failed silently; fix is in progress. Interim workaround: point the scraper at the Matchcore telemetry endpoint using the key below.

app token of bawep-hafog = kto7_vwrmnlx